The Backup Battery Advantage: Why It Beats a Gas Generator
When looking for home standby power, many homeowners naturally consider loud, fuel-burning gas or propane generators. However, pairing clean solar power with modern lithium-iron-phosphate (LFP) battery storage provides a far more efficient, reliable, and maintenance-free mechanical solution:
1. Instantaneous Micro-Grid Transition
When the Long Island grid drops, a standby generator takes anywhere from 10 to 30 seconds to start engine combustion and transfer power. A smart solar battery system, like the Enphase Encharge or Tesla Powerwall, utilizes internal automatic transfer switches that sense a power drop instantly. The system isolates your home’s electrical loop and restores power in milliseconds—so fast your digital clocks won’t even blink.
2. Perpetual Daytime Recharging
A standard backup generator relies on an external fuel source. If a severe coastal storm closes local fuel stations or blocks major roadways, you face a hard operational limit once your fuel tank runs dry. A solar battery system builds a self-sustaining loop: your solar panels power your essential home loads and recharge your batteries during the day, and the batteries quietly sustain your household throughout the night.

Smart Management: Defining Your Critical Loads
You don’t necessarily need to invest in a massive, industrial-scale battery bank to protect your family’s daily peace of mind. During our structural site design phase, we work with you to map out your home’s specific electrical layout, routing your most critical structural assets into a dedicated backup sub-panel:
| Essential Emergency Loads | Luxury Comfort Loads |
| Sump Pumps & Well Pumps (Prevents flooding) | Central Air Conditioning Units (High draw) |
| Refrigerators & Deep Freezers (Protects food) | Electric Vehicle (EV) Fast Charging Ports |
| Medical Equipment & CPAP Devices | Hot Tubs, Pool Pumps, & Electric Saunas |
| Home Wi-Fi, Routers, & Phone Charging | Secondary Guest Suite Lighting Circuits |
By isolating your absolute essentials, a single or dual-battery configuration can comfortably sustain your household through extended, multi-day grid blackouts without breaking your project budget.
